Synthesis and enzymic activity of some new purine ring system analogs of adenosine 3'5'-cyclic monophosphate

G Sagi, K Szucs, G Vereb, L Otvos

Index: Sagi; Szucs; Vereb; Otvos Journal of Medicinal Chemistry, 1992 , vol. 35, # 24 p. 4549 - 4556

Full Text: HTML

Citation Number: 15

Abstract

A series of novel adenosine 3', 5'-cyclic monophosphate (CAMP) analogues, as well as their 6-deamino and 6-nitro derivatives, were synthesized where the purine ring was replaced by indazole, benzotriazole, and benzimidazole. The 3', 5'-cyclic monophosphates of indazole and benzotriazole ribofuranosides, where the sugar-phosphate moiety is attached to the N-2 nitrogen atoms of the heterocycles, were also prepared.
